Publisher Marketing: Family. A six letter word that holds a meaning stronger than those six letters can convey. How far would you go for yours? What happens when the one thing you want is the one thing you don't have? Boston is sixteen and has lived at Madame Louise's orphanage almost his entire life. The one thing he wants more than anything else is a family of his own. What he needs are parents. Over the years he was joined by three boys that have become his brothers, the closest thing to family he has. After years of waiting the four boys have run out of options and patience. So together, Boston, Theo, Wyatt, and Bo set out to find parents to call their own. But a step outside the orphanage walls isn't a vacation in paradise. The year is 2018 and the United States is recovering from a flu epidemic that has ravaged the population. Entire companies and corporations have shut down. In their wake they've left countless people homeless and desperate. People who are willing to do almost anything to survive. The boys must survive a bitter world trying to rebuild from the depths of despair. Conquer hunger, loneliness and those who would do them harm. Can they find the family they are longing for or will they forever be just four more forgotten children? The boys are fictional but there are 153 million real children in the world just like them; Children who are alone, unloved and have no hope. This but one fictional example of the millions that truly that exist. The story of the Forgotten.
